Oshkosh 2006 Website Ready For Action

Mark The Dates -- July 24-30, 2006, ANN Will Be There!

Although opening day is still nearly eight months away, the preparations have already started for the 54th annual EAA AirVenture Oshkosh, The World's Greatest Aviation Celebration, coming July 24-30, 2006. The event, which draws more than 10,000 airplanes from around the world, has been held at Wittman Regional Airport in Oshkosh since 1970.

The event's newly updated website is now available and contains the latest updates for the fly-in, which in 2005 drew an unmatched aircraft lineup that included SpaceShipOne/White Knight and the Virgin Atlantic Global Flyer. The EAA AirVenture website will highlight the latest news and aircraft confirmations, essential information such as admission rates and housing; and other important information to create an unforgettable visitor experience in 2006.

"We are already eagerly anticipating welcoming the world of flight back to Oshkosh in 2006," said Tom Poberezny, EAA president and AirVenture chairman. "EAA AirVenture is THE place where innovation and ingenuity are on prominent display; where government officials meet and hear their constituents; where aviation personalities tell their stories; and where all of aviation returns for its annual family reunion."

The schedule of events and confirmed lineup of aircraft will be announced as those items are finalized.

The EAA AirVenture web site again features easy-to-use menus to help people plan their participation at the event. Information is categorized under areas such as "Discover It," "Plan for It," "Experience It," and "Follow It." There are also added photo and video areas for people to enjoy the full range of activities at EAA AirVenture.

"People should plan to join us at Oshkosh this year, because there's no better place to experience the world of flight in one location," Poberezny said.

"Now is the time to begin planning a journey to EAA AirVenture. We promise you an experience unmatched anywhere else in aviation."
